>>>How exactly is a gearbox better than an automatic!? Apart from cramp in the
>>>left foot when changing from 1st to 2nd 300 times a second? 8o)
>>Automatic gearing for bicycles has never caught on, because there's a
>>certain increase in friction; for a given speed there's more than one
>>gear you might want to use depending on whether you're accelerating
>>hard, cruising, planning to increase speed slowly, or whatever; and
>>gear changes cause unpredictable fluctuations in the drive power.
>>I believe that motor cars suffer from all these issues too, but to a
>>lesser degree, which is what makes automatics a feasible alternative.
